Game Day Flow
Check-In & Warm-Up
Plan to arrive at Kern Sports Complex at least 45 to 60 minutes before your scheduled game time, especially during busy tournament weekends. This buffer allows ample time for parking, navigating to the correct field or court, and completing any necessary team check-in procedures. Familiarize yourselves with the complex map beforehand to locate your assigned area efficiently. Utilize the designated warm-up zones to get players ready while other team members can organize gear and set up any personal canopies or seating. Ensure coaches have all necessary paperwork and player rosters available for quick verification by tournament staff. Hydration is key, so confirm water coolers are accessible or that personal water bottles are filled.

California Living Museum (CALM)
CALM is a unique zoo and living museum focusing on California's native plants and animals, offering an engaging experience for all ages. Visitors can observe a variety of local wildlife, including bears, mountain lions, and coyotes, in naturalistic habitats. The museum also features a historic carousel and a petting zoo, making it a family-friendly destination. It provides an educational and entertaining outing, perfect for filling time between games or for a full-day excursion beyond the sports complex.

Weather & Seasons at Kern Sports Complex
- Winter: Winter in Bakersfield is mild, with average daytime temperatures ranging from the low 50s to the mid-60s Fahrenheit. While snow is rare, you might encounter cool, crisp air and the possibility of rain. Dressing in layers is advisable, with a light jacket or sweater being essential for mornings and evenings. Outdoor activities are generally comfortable, but be prepared for potential event delays or cancellations if significant rainfall occurs.
- Spring & early summer: Spring ushers in warmer weather, with temperatures climbing into the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it. This is a prime time for outdoor sports, offering pleasant conditions for participants and spectators. Light clothing is suitable for daytime events, but a light jacket may be needed for cooler evenings. The risk of rain decreases significantly as summer approaches, making it an ideal period for tournaments.
- Mid-summer: Summers in Bakersfield are characterized by significant heat, with temperatures frequently reaching the high 90s and often exceeding 100 degrees Fahrenheit. Outdoor activities require caution; early morning or late afternoon events are strongly recommended. Hydration is paramount, and sun protection, including hats and sunscreen, is crucial. Indoor or shaded areas become highly sought after during the hottest parts of the day.
- Fall season: Fall brings a return to comfortable temperatures, with highs typically in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, gradually cooling into the 60s. This season is ideal for sports, offering warm days and cooler evenings, perfect for athletic performance. Layers are recommended, as mornings can be chilly, warming up considerably by midday.
